Summary
In this episode of the Digital Economics Podcast, I sit down with Sélim Benayat, co-founder and CEO of Bento, a popular micropage tool that was acquired by Linktree. Bento allows users to consolidate their online presence by offering a customizable link connecting to various social media profiles, personal websites, and portfolios. Sélim discusses the initial inspiration behind Bento, its development journey, and the philosophy of product-led growth that fueled its success. He explains how focusing on making users look as good as possible was a key principle in driving organic growth and community engagement. Sélim also shares his thoughts on the importance of building communities around products, which can offer valuable user insights and foster long-term relationships. Reflecting on Bento’s acquisition by Linktree, he talks about the strategic reasons behind the decision, emphasizing scale and the shared vision of creating more user-centric online destinations.
